Guys, help me out here. There are three files in my c drive namely
1.AcroIEHelper.dll
2.AcroPDF.dll
3.pdfshell.dll
that refuse to go. When i try to delete I get an error message
"Acess is denied. Make sure the disk is mot full or right protected."
when i format the partition the files remain intact. i have tried file shredders but they fail to delete the files.
they exist in this location and even in the partition where i have windows installed
C and D:\Program Files\Common Files\Adobe\Acrobat\ActiveX
if you know a way i can delete these files please let me know.
I currently have windows in the d drive.

After Uninstalltion of certain softwares some DLL files are left behind so that OS/other SOftwares can make use of them.

These DLL files are left behind after you uninstalled some Adobe Product, let them be there as OS or some other software may be using them and moreover such files just takes KB of space so why bother :)

Some .dll files do not get deleted when you uninstall the software using Windows Uninstaller. So, use revo uninstaller. IF this even doesn,t work then use any unlocker software and use it to delete those files.
